The Composition of Platineve
Platineve typically consists of 92.5% silver and 5% platinum, with the remaining 2.5% made up of other metals such as copper. This composition gives Platineve its unique characteristics, making it a durable and lustrous metal that is perfect for creating exquisite jewelry pieces.

Caring for Platineve Jewelry
To keep your Platineve jewelry looking its best, it is essential to care for it properly. To clean Platineve pieces, simply use a mild soap and water solution and a soft cloth to gently wipe away any dirt or oils.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as these can damage the metal. With proper care, your Platineve jewelry will continue to shine and dazzle for years to come.
